Post by: Marhis on March 13, 2007, 11:33:49 pm For some mysterious reasons, which only Aspyr may know, TS2 seems to be the only Mac application which works only if placed in specific places on the hard disk. If you install TS2 in the Application folder, as logic may suggest, instead of Macintosh HD root, or a "Games" folder in your account, the game may not work, or act strange.
I'm sorry but I don't know any solution other than re-place the game folder and documents one where they were before :(. All this mess should be related with the invisible extension Aspyr put on game related folders (".localized"), to recognize the correct ones; I've made some experiments in the past, but with no much luck, I'm afraid.
